Gonna give the LSD one more hoon on the track then i'ma swap it out for a viscous unit.

 

In other news, oil consumption is holding steady but the car is throwing out some decent blue clouds after engine braking.  Clubsub nats is in May so i'll be attending that and attempting to relive my engine of its conrods.

 

New block will shortly be in the shed.  I have acquired a complete 1st gen EZ30.  Have a few options on what to do with it;

 

1)  Remove heads, swap shortblock in with my better heads on it.  Low cost, relatively easy, no power gains but a much fresher block.

 

2)  Keep the old motor as a spare, slam a turbo on the new one with stock internals and see what happens.  Have seen others make an extremely drivable reliable 250wkw....which is regarded as the limit for a Subaru 5speed box.

 

3)  Keep the current engine going as long as possible and use the time to acquire turbo parts and some new rods n pistons.  Swap my good heads onto the new block and have an utterly monstrous demon motor capable of a drivetrain destroying reliable 450wkw.  Obviously this option has issues such as costing a lot more than id like it to and producing enough power to affect the rotation of the earth.  Also, without spending 3k on a 6 speed gearbox swap, I would need electroshock therapy to program some restraint into my brain.

 

Some other combination of forced induction, heads and blocks would also be doable.  I have no idea which way I want to go yet.  All I know is that my current engine has a finite lifespan that im approaching the end of.  Funny how its lasted around 200,000kms exactly the same as the first one.
